The National Instruments GPIB-120B is a GPIB Bus Expander and Isolator, widely recognized by part numbers 779651-01, 779651-04, 779651-06, and 779651-07. This device is engineered for complete compatibility with IEEE 488.1 and IEEE 488.2 standards, allowing users to expand their GPIB bus to connect as many as 28 devices in various test and measurement environments. The GPIB-120B provides exceptional isolation capabilities, offering up to 2,500 VDC of non-continuous isolation between GPIB ports and the power supply, effectively mitigating induced common-mode and ground loop noise. This isolation feature ensures reliable communication between instruments and the IEEE 488 bus controller.
The expander facilitates bidirectional expansion of GPIB system devices, accommodating talkers, listeners, and controllers on either side. Functionally transparent, the GPIB-120B allows existing GPIB control and communication programs to operate seamlessly in both standard and expanded configurations. It supports two data transfer modes: buffered mode with transfer rates up to 1.2 MB/s and unbuffered mode up to 450 kB/s, with unbuffered mode set as the default. Users can easily switch between operating modes using the toggle switch located on the rear of the device. The unit incorporates eight data lines and three hardware handshake lines for comprehensive communication capabilities. Compactly designed with dimensions of 6.30 by 3.68 by 1.24 inches and weighing 8.64 ounces, the GPIB-120B is an indispensable component for enhancing GPIB system functionality.
